Clan MacGregor whisky honours the MacGregors, one of Scotland's oldest clans. The real life Clan MacGregor has a renowned history dating back to the 14th Century. The bottle includes The Lion's Head, the personal crest of the 24th Clan Chief , Sir Gregor MacGregor. This Whisky is blended and bottled by Alexander MacGregor & Company of Glasgow. It is a Fine Rare Blend of 15 Malt Whiskies and selected Grain Whiskies. It is said that the Kininvie Distillery, located in the backyard of The Balvenie, is the main Malt used in Clan MacGregor.

Type: Blended Scotch ABV: 40% Producer: William Grant & Sons Malt Source: Primarily
Kininvie Distillery Blend: 15 malt and grain whiskies from Highlands, Lowlands, and Speyside
Nose :- Grainy and cracker-like. Floral notes with pine and beeswax. Hints of vanilla, malt, and citrus
Palate:- Sweet entry with caramel and honey. Midpalate shows pipe tobacco, tar, and cereal grain. Some reviews note banana, dark chocolate, and baking spices like nutmeg and allspice
Finish:- Clean and sweet. Lingering malt, brine, and faint peat. Some tasters report a biscuity or baked apple character
Overall Impression
Clan MacGregor is a light, mellow, and approachable blend, ideal for mixing or casual sipping. The use of Kininvie malt adds a Speyside softness, and its floral-grainy profile makes it a decent Scotch.
